Today's Gospel: Luke 17:1-6

Sin. We cannot escape it and sometimes we cannot even recognize it! Forgiveness, we cannot escape either, but we must recognize it and administer it to each other  freely. Offering forgiveness each time we are hurt is what is expected of us, and that is not easy! There are times when forgiveness is harder than others, but they are equally necessary for our salvation.

We must increase our faith and remember the saying “I have a mustard seed, and I am not afraid to use it!” We can move mountains in our lives, crazy situations and hard times, with faith. I have personally never uprooted a tree before, but it would happen if my faith was that strong; I believe it.

This Gospel includes a lot of hard things to grasp. There are times when we cause others to sin, and knowing how seriously Jesus speaks about this should make us pause and consider our daily actions prayerfully. We need to prayerfully consider why Jesus says we must forgive others despite the number of infractions and no matter what. Dying on the cross, after suffering heinous beatings, Jesus forgave us, so, therefore, we can forgive others for much smaller matters. It is a conscious decision every minute of the day. It is up to us, but we have help! Our Holy Mother, the Holy Spirit, our guardian angel, Jesus, and our Heavenly Father all can and will be there for us when we need help.  I love our holy Church for all the gifts of help we have in her!
